Alex Cormier of Sydney Mines is pictured with her recent release, "I loved you by Christmas." CONTRIBUTED - CONTRIBUTEDSYDNEY, N.S. — A novella first written when she was a lonely teenager nearly 20 years ago is generating plenty of attention these days for Sydney Mines native Alex Cormier.
Alex Cormier's newly released book,"I love you by Christmas," is sold by U.S. retailer Barnes & Noble. CONTRIBUTED - CONTRIBUTED“I loved you by Christmas” was originally written when Cormier was just 16. She drew her inspiration for the book from movies and literature. Cormier went on to self-publish four non-fiction books before returning to the story she first penned 18 years ago.
“A reader had inboxed me on my business page and sent the link. ‘I loved you by Christmas’ is the fifth book that I’ve published but this is the first time one of my books has been picked up by Barnes & Noble.
